📖 The story of the name Aly

Aly is a refined and international spelling of the great Arabic name Ali, which means "the elevated, the noble, the sublime." Rooted in the ʿ-l-w root, it evokes everything that rises: dignity, high-mindedness, and nobility of spirit. It is one of the most widespread and respected names in the Muslim world.

Its foundational figure is Ali ibn Abi Talib, cousin and son-in-law of the Prophet Muhammad, husband of Fatima, fourth Caliph of Islam, and first Imam for Shia Muslims. His reputation for wisdom, bravery, and justice caused the name to shine for centuries and across continents. In the 20th century, the boxer Muhammad Ali bestowed an additional global aura upon it, becoming a symbol of pride and gallantry.

The form Aly, with its final 'y', is particularly present in Francophone West Africa (Senegal, Mali) and among families who appreciate its elegant and modern touch. Today, Aly is perceived as a noble, warm, and universal name—short yet strong.

❓ Frequently asked questions about Aly

What does the name Aly mean?

Aly means "elevated, noble, sublime" — from the Arabic root expressing elevation.

What is the difference between Aly and Ali?

None in meaning: Aly is a spelling of the same name, widely used in Francophone West Africa.

Who is the reference figure for the name?

Ali ibn Abi Talib, cousin and son-in-law of the Prophet Muhammad, fourth Caliph and first Shia Imam.

Does Aly have a feast day?

No, this name is not linked to the saints' calendar and has no official feast date.

Is it a popular name?

Yes, Ali/Aly is one of the most common male names in the Muslim world, with a strong presence in France.
